A national subsidy program is driving a significant boost in consumer demand for automobiles, with a recent report highlighting the impact in Shandong Province.
On August 5th, at a new energy vehicle sales outlet in Xinghua Road Subdistrict, Licang District, Qingdao, Shandong Province, a customer inquired about government trade-in subsidy policies. The Qingdao Municipal Commerce Bureau has announced that the city's automotive trade-in subsidy quota for August this year stands at 2.5 billion yuan (approximately $350 million USD), covering both vehicle scrappage and replacement categories.
